1.1 Explore the Flower Market
The Cours Saleya Flower Market at the Old Town stands as one of the notable attractions within this district. During winter months the market maintains active business throughout the day. The stalls at this place display a variety of fresh flowers together with local products and seasonal produce. The traditional Nice dish socca which consists of chickpea pancakes should be sampled when visiting.

5. Indulge in Local Cuisine
The experience of tasting the traditional local food is necessary to finish your Nice journey. Winter provides the ideal season to enjoy filling recipes which will bring comfort to your body. Experience the authentic Niçoise dishes by trying these traditional local fare:
Shoppers should experience Salade Niçoise which consists of local fresh ingredients combining tomatoes with olives and tuna as well as anchovies and boiled eggs.
- Daube Niçoise stands as a delicious beef stew which receives its unique flavor from red wine and various herbs with vegetables.
- Pissaladière entails a tart made with savory onions and garnished with black olives together with anchovies.
- A traditional Niçoise experience can be completed by matching these foods with local Rosé wine.
5.1 Sample Local Treats
Tourists visiting Nice should taste traditional snacks like socca (from the previous topic) combined with the pan bagnat tuna sandwich and tourte de blettes Swiss chard tart. You can find these pleasant treats in Nice to experience authentic regional flavors that meet your cravings perfectly.
